Abstract
Objective:To investigate the effect of continuous blood purification combined Ulinastatin on inflammation of patients with severe sepsis,as well as the clinical outcomes.Methods: 70 cases with severe sepsis subsequently divided into control group(n=22),CBP group(n=23) and CBP+ Ulinastatin group(n=25).The control group received classical treatment.the CBP group was added with continuous blood purification,and the CBP+ Ulinastatin group with Ulinastatin.The development of disease was observed,and the blood biochemical parameters,coagulation index and arterial blood gas analyses were evaluated before and after treatment.ELISA was used to quantify the serum concentration of CRP.Results: ①Compared with control and CBP group,the case-fatality rate,length of ICU stay and rate of MODS significantly decreased in CBP+ Ulinastatin group(P0.05).②After treatment,the APACHE II score CBP+Ulinastatin group fell to 15.46±3.96,significantly lower than control group(18.06±4.25) and CBP group(17.14±5.55)(P0.05).③ The levels of BUN and HR was lowest in CBP+ Ulinastatin group,followed successively by CBP and control group.(P0.05) But no difference was found in PH,HCO3-and MAP among groups(P0.05).④ After treatment,the levels of serum CRP and WBC significantly decreased,especially in CBP+Ulinastatin group(P0.05).⑤PT,TT and APTT increased in all patients,and PLT decreased.The PT and APTT was shorter in CBP+Ulinastatin group than control and CBP group(P0.05).Conclusion: Combination of continuous blood purification and Ulinastatin for the treatment of severe sepsis can inhibit inflammatory response,reduce the severity of the sepsis,and improve prognosis.
